When I took over for the last membership clerk, I found out that our "Bear Den" was missing. I was able to "Split" the Wolf Den and create a "Pseudo-Bear Den" in the meantime. However, the problem I have is, this isn't the "default" class. Which runs into the issue that the wolf dens doesn't move to the Bear den and the Bear den doesn't move to webelos.

Is there a way to get the "default Bear Den Back".

I already tried to "Reset Classes to Default" on the main Primary page.

I did notice the on the main "Boy Scouts" section of YM, I do have the ability to "Add Variety" and "Add Venturing", but the Cubs doesn't seem to have the same feature.

One possibility is that the Bear Den was combined with another den and renamed. In that case there should be an Uncombine option for one of the dens when clicking on the pencil icon beside the name.

The other is that the Remove Class option was used. If that's the case, I'm not sure how to get back just that one class.

However, if you click the pencil icon beside the Primary heading at the top there is an option to reset classes to defaults. That should recover the missing den. But it will probably also reset all other primary classes to their defaults. So if you have any combined or split classes or non-standard assignments, you'll want to make a printout of the Primary organization and redo all the changes.
